Why is the roles and users management feature significant in Sitefinity?

The roles and users management feature in Sitefinity is significant primarily because it enhances security through managing user access and permissions. By implementing a robust system for defining roles, Sitefinity allows administrators to control who can access specific areas of the website, what actions they can perform, and which content they can view or edit. This capability is essential for maintaining the integrity of the website and ensuring that sensitive information is protected from unauthorized access.

Effective user management also allows organizations to implement a principle of least privilege, ensuring that users only have the access necessary for their roles. This minimizes the risk of security breaches and helps in maintaining compliance with various regulatory standards. In a multi-user environment, especially within larger organizations, this feature becomes crucial in streamlining workflows and reducing the potential for errors or misuse of information.
